Tasting Notes
Soft whispering spicy floral aromatic Shiraz showing elegant cool climate, spice and peppery note.
Ageing Potential
Enjoy now or for the next 5 years.

In The Vineyard
Soil Type: Deep Clay soils of the Bokkeveld series
Aspect: North and North West
Age of Vines: 5 and 6 years
Vines per hectare: 5500
These Walker Bay vineyards of Hemel en Aarde Ridge are situated within close proximity to the Atlantic Ocean. The maritime climate being more “temperate” in style, where parallel mountain ranges channel the southerly sea breezes through the appellation during the summer. These winds in turn bring regular sea mists and overcast conditions to the valley and with it more even temperatures. The average temperature is 19°C and rainfall, approximately, 750mm per year.
About The Harvest
The 2 blocks of Shiraz were harvested separately by hand enjoying cool early morning temperatures. The grapes were harvested in 2 different batches throughout March. This was carried out in order to add complexity to the wines’ profile. Earlier picking to capture aromatic freshness and later picking for body and weight.
In The Cellar
After overnight cold storage grapes were destemmed and crushed into red ferment tanks. Cold maceration occurred for 5 – 7 days. The wine was then fermented under controlled temperatures until dry. The skins were then lightly pressed and the wine racked into a selection of French Oak Barriques (30% new barrels) for 15 months ageing and maturation. Final blending occurred 2 months prior to bottling and the wine was allowed to develop further in bottle prior to release.
